A pipe 0.026 m in diameter and 0.22 m long can transfer 3476 J of heat per second with a temperature difference across the ends of 7?C. Compare this performance with the heat transfer of a solid silver bar of the same di- mensions by finding the ratio of the given heat to that of the silver bar. The thermal conduc- tivity of silver is 427 W/m · ? C. (Silver is the best heat conductor of all metals.)
